Add NetIdManagerTest

Add a simple test to verify that IDs loop correctly, that they skip used
IDs correctly, and throw when there is no remaining ID.

Test: atest com.android.server.NetIdManagerTest

package com.android.server
import androidx.test.filters.SmallTest
import androidx.test.runner.AndroidJUnit4
import com.android.server.NetIdManager.MIN_NET_ID
import com.android.testutils.ExceptionUtils.ThrowingRunnable
import com.android.testutils.assertThrows
import org.junit.Test
import org.junit.runner.RunWith
import kotlin.test.assertEquals
@RunWith(AndroidJUnit4::class)
@SmallTest
class NetIdManagerTest {
@Test
fun testReserveReleaseNetId() {
val manager = NetIdManager(MIN_NET_ID + 4)
assertEquals(MIN_NET_ID, manager.reserveNetId())
assertEquals(MIN_NET_ID + 1, manager.reserveNetId())
assertEquals(MIN_NET_ID + 2, manager.reserveNetId())
assertEquals(MIN_NET_ID + 3, manager.reserveNetId())
manager.releaseNetId(MIN_NET_ID + 1)
manager.releaseNetId(MIN_NET_ID + 3)
// IDs only loop once there is no higher ID available
assertEquals(MIN_NET_ID + 4, manager.reserveNetId())
assertEquals(MIN_NET_ID + 1, manager.reserveNetId())
assertEquals(MIN_NET_ID + 3, manager.reserveNetId())
assertThrows(IllegalStateException::class.java, ThrowingRunnable { manager.reserveNetId() })
manager.releaseNetId(MIN_NET_ID + 5)
// Still no ID available: MIN_NET_ID + 5 was not reserved
assertThrows(IllegalStateException::class.java, ThrowingRunnable { manager.reserveNetId() })
manager.releaseNetId(MIN_NET_ID + 2)
// Throwing an exception still leaves the manager in a working state
assertEquals(MIN_NET_ID + 2, manager.reserveNetId())
}
}
